Access Bank Nigeria Plc has announced the resignation of Mr. Obinna David Nwosu as its Group Deputy Managing Director.
The announcement made via the Nigerian Stock Exchange’s issuers portal on Wednesday, and signed by the company Secretary, Sunday Ekwochi said the resignation which came on the heels of his decision to pursue other personal endeavors is effective from April 30th, 2017.
The statement read that Mr. Nwosu has confirmed he has no disagreement with the Board and there is no matter relating to his resignation that needs to be brought to the attention of the shareholders of the company or the regulatory authorities.
With the retirement of Mr. Nwosu, the company no =w has fifteen directors comprising nin-Executive Directors and six Executive Directors.
“The board will like to express its profound gratitude to Mr. Nwosu for his contributions and services to the company and wises him success in his future endeavours” the statement concluded
